Mike P 3,425 Posted June 4, 2024 Posted June 4, 2024 Well the promised code syntax highlighting is here (10.91.1). It doesn't have my favourite language, but I can live with that. The problem (and there always is a problem with EN releases) is that they decided to extend spellchecking to the code block As soon as you edit a note (you don't need to actually click inside the code block) the red appears.
